Update: ‘Ape Jana Bala Party’ leader dies in Beliatta shooting

Date:

January 22, Colombo (LNW): Leader of the political party ‘Ape Jana Bala Pakshaya’ Saman Perera is reportedly among the five persons killed in the shooting incident in Beliatta, Tangalla area earlier this (22) morning.

The ‘Ape Jana Bala Pakshaya’ gained a parliamentary seat in the last General Election and Ven. Athuraliya Ratana Thera entered Parliament representing the party.

It was noteworthy that Secretary of the Bodu Bala Sena Galagoda Aththe Gnanasara Thera also contested the polls through the ‘Ape Jana Bala Pakshaya.’
